Meanwhile, I brought my buddy who was looking to add another tank. the tank itself is a basic 90 gallon Reef Ready with corner overflow.
You can tell he put lots of effort and money into the system over time. He is a nice enough guy and he does still have great fish!
Sadly, after that July 3rd Micro Burst/Tornado he had a water breach in his basement and it actually compromised the sump system water with external ground /rain water into his sump in the basement, probably lowering the salinity/ALK of the system. Sadly the corals are no longer in the shape Eric posted originally.
So as I mentioned to Eric as well, Mark had lost/is loosing a lot of corals due to the Salinity/probable ALK swings, and large aptasia are doing a number on several of the other LPS/SPS.
Mushrooms and Zoas/Palys still all look solid.
Not sure of the age of the Tank, Stand, and Hood, but he has 2 older XR15 and an XR30 on it, but Gen2.
The sump is a large acrylic sump with x-large skimmer. You can tell the RODI unit needs new filters/DI Resin. Connected to the sump is a brute full of live rock for extra biological filtration, which is a plus.
Rock isn't cheap. He also has a Chiller to include, which is nice.
The money is in the Fish and Corals, Chiller, Light, Sump/Skimmer and rock.
He was asking $3,000 for all, which is a bit high in my opinion, but if someone wants to reset it back up, grab some berghia nudibranch and let them clear the auptasia before adding the wrasses back, it could be a great set up with nice lights good filtration. Honestly he is not too far off on the used tank, equipment, lights, rock, chiller, and livestock...but do to the hit on the condition of the corals, he should probably be asking closer to $2k now.
